# Break-Glass: Catalog Cache Invalidation

Scope: the Pinrow product catalog at Veldstone Retail. If stale prices persist after a purge and the Hollowmere invalidation queue is wedged, use break-glass to flush the edge tier directly. Contractors: get verbal sign-off from the catalog lead first. Steps: open the Hollowmere admin shell, select emergency-flush, confirm the tenant, and run it once — repeated flushes thrash the origin. Access is logged and expires after 20 minutes. Unseal the admin shell with the passphrase below.

recovery phrase for kahop-tajog: istix-casvan

**Q: Why does Spanwright refuse to diff files over 2 GB?**

Spanwright's plugin sandbox caps memory per diff pass. For larger files, enable chunked mode in your plugin manifest; partial hunks are streamed and reassembled. Chunked mode requires unlocking the local index cache, which is sealed with the recovery passphrase below.

vault phrase of yawig-bawig = fenael-norael-eliox-gilox-casath-druath-zorys-istwyn-jorwyn

* This block initializes the renderer that draws the hall's seat map
 * from the Parterre layout service. Support staff: if customers report
 * blank maps, check that the layout cache has not expired (TTL is six
 * hours) before escalating. The client retries three times with
 * backoff; a fourth failure logs SEATSCAPE_LAYOUT_DOWN. Zones are
 * colored by price tier fetched at render time, so stale tiers mean a
 * stale cache. The Parterre client authenticates with the internal
 * key given on the next line.
 */

gateway credential: kto7_GoY89Me

Subject: Antique clock — repair shipment

Dispatch team,

The longcase clock from the Pellham boardroom is crated and waiting in the mailroom. It's heading to Wrenfield Horology for movement repair. The crate is marked fragile on all sides; please assign a two-person lift and a padded van. Insurance paperwork is taped inside the lid. Follow the hand-over instruction below at drop-off.

handover note for yagef-bagep: the drudor pelius courier leaves the kasdor zorvan norir ledger at gate 8016 under passcode 755406